13. PRIORITY OF SERVICE (Continued)
13.5 Priority of Interruptible and PAL Service
Interruptible transportation service and PAL service under this
FERC Gas Tariff Original Volume No. 1 shall be provided when, and
to the extent that, capacity is available in NBP's existing
facilities, which capacity is not subject to a prior claim under a
pre-existing contract, service agreement, certificate or under
firm service. NBP will provide interruptible and PAL service, as
set forth in Paragraph 8.2 of these General Terms and Conditions
of Service, first to shippers paying the highest Maximum Rate (or
a Negotiated Rate equal to or in excess of the highest Maximum
Rate). NBP will next allocate capacity to Shippers paying a
discounted or Negotiated Rate to the Shipper(s) paying the next
highest rate until all capacity has been awarded. In the event of
a tie, NBP shall award capacity on a pro rata basis.
